BEML Signs Licensing Agreements with DRDO to Manufacture Advanced Combat Support Vehicles for Army

  • BEML Limited entered into three licensing agreements with the Vehicles Research and Development Establishment (VRDE), a premier DRDO laboratory, for the Transfer of Technology to manufacture critical mobility and support systems for the Indian Army's Armoured Corps.
  • Under these agreements, Bharat Earth Movers Limited (BEML) will indigenously develop and produce the Unit Maintenance Vehicle (UMV) and Unit Repair Vehicle (URV) for MBT Arjun, and the Full Trailer for 70T Tank Transporter equipped with an Advanced Hydraulic Suspension System.

Key NSG Counter-Terror Event Held, Focus on Unified Response

  • In the wake of the terror attack in Jammu and Kashmir's Pahalgam and India's response in the form of Operation Sindoor, the 23rd edition of the National Security Guard's (NSG) Counter-Terror International Seminar was held in New Delhi. The seminar saw key steps taken towards framing a unified Standard Operating Procedure for counterterrorism coordination.
  • The two-day event, inaugurated by Junior Home Minister Nityanand Rai, was themed 'Forging Collaboration and Innovation to Counter Terror Threats and Address the Complexities of Modern Terrorism'.
  • A major highlight of the seminar was the signing of a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) between the NSG and police forces of states and Union Territories. This landmark agreement lays the groundwork for a unified CT coordination standard operating procedure (SOP), institutionalised joint training, and enhanced First Responder interoperability across the nation.

Navy to Induct First Anti-Submarine Warfare Shallow Water Craft 'Arnala'

  • The first warship in the anti-submarine warfare shallow water craft series, equipped to conduct subsurface surveillance, search and rescue missions, and low-intensity maritime operations, is set to be inducted into the Indian Navy on June 18.
  • The commissioning ceremony of 'Arnala' at Naval Dockyard, Visakhapatnam will be presided over by Chief of Defence Staff Gen Anil Chauhan.
  • The warship incorporates more than 80 per cent indigenous content and integrates advanced systems from leading Indian defence firms, including Bharat Electronics Limited (BEL), L&T, Mahindra Defence, and MEIL.
  • Designed and constructed by Garden Reach Shipbuilders & Engineers (GRSE), Kolkata, under a public-private partnership (PPP) with L&T Shipbuilders, 'Arnala' is a testament to the success of the 'Aatmanirbhar Bharat' initiative in defence manufacturing.

India, Mongolia Holding Joint Military Drill 'Nomadic Elephant 2025'

  • The 17th edition of the joint military exercise 'Nomadic Elephant 2025' between India and Mongolia is underway at the Special Forces Training Centre in Ulaanbaatar, Mongolia.
  • According to the Indian Army, the training focuses on conducting non-conventional operations in semi-urban and mountainous terrain under a United Nations mandate. The objective is to enhance the operational capabilities of both forces. Participating contingents are actively exchanging best practices in counter-terrorism operations and precision sniping, thereby improving interoperability.
  • The 'Nomadic Elephant 2025' exercise began on May 31 and is concludes on June 13, 2025.

Tata to Build Rafale Fighter Jet Fuselage under Deal with Dassault Aviation

  • Adding to its growing aerospace manufacturing capability, Tata Advanced Systems (TASL) signed agreements with France's Dassault Aviation to manufacture the Rafale fighter aircraft fuselage in India.
  • Tata will set up a dedicated manufacturing facility in Hyderabad to make the four main parts of the fuselage for Indian requirements as well as Dassault's global orders.

Uttar Pradesh Approves 20% Police Reservation for Ex-Agniveers

  • The Yogi Adityanath-led Uttar Pradesh government approved 20% reservation for former Agniveers in state police recruitment. The decision was taken during a cabinet meeting.
  • According to the official announcement, the reservation will apply to direct recruitment in several key categories within the police department, including civil police constables, PAC (Provincial Armed Constabulary), mounted police constables, and firemen.
  • As per the state government, the quota is intended to support the integration of ex-Agniveers into civil services after their four-year military service under the Agnipath scheme. The move is part of Uttar Pradesh's larger effort to provide post-service employment opportunities to Agniveers and recognise their contribution to national defence.
